Synonyms and antonyms of Human and animal waste in American Thesaurus

Human and animal waste

cowchip (noun)

Americaninformal a hard dried cowpie

cowpie (noun)

Americaninformal a round flat piece of solid waste from a cow

crap (noun)

impolite solid waste that has left your body

doo-doo (noun)

informal solid waste from the body. This word is used mainly by children or when speaking to children.

droppings (noun)

the feces (=solid waste) of animals or birds

dung (noun)

waste from the body of a large animal such as an elephant or a cow

excrement (noun)

formal the solid waste that your body gets rid of

excreta (noun)

the liquid and solid waste that your body gets rid of

excretion (noun)

waste that you get rid of from your body

faeces ()

the British spelling of feces

feces (noun)

the solid waste that comes out of your body

guano (noun)

solid waste from birds or other animals, sometimes spread on the ground to help plants grow

manure (noun)

solid waste from farm animals, often mixed with other substances and used on crops to help them to grow

mess (noun)

solid waste from an animal

midden (noun)

an old word meaning “a pile of garbage” or “a pile of animal feces”

movement (noun)

medical a bowel movement

muck (noun)

waste matter from animals, especially when it is spread on fields to improve the soil

number two (noun)

solid waste from the bowels. This word is used by children and when talking to children.

pee (noun)

informal the liquid waste that you pass from your body. A more formal word for this is urine.

piss (noun)

impolite the waste liquid that your body gets rid of. A more polite word is pee. The formal word is urine.

poo (noun)

Britishinformal solid waste from the body. This word is used mainly by children or when speaking to children.

poop (noun)

Americaninformal solid waste that comes out of your body when you go to the bathroom. This word is used especially by and to children.

poo-poo (noun)

poop

scatological (adjective)

formal referring to solid waste from the human body in a way that people find offensive

shit (noun)

impolite solid waste from a person’s or animal’s body

stool (noun)

a piece of solid waste from someone’s body

turd (noun)

impolite a solid piece of waste from a person’s or an animal’s body

urea (noun)

a substance found in urine (=liquid waste from your body)

urine (noun)

liquid waste from a person’s or animal’s body
